Which of the following terms is related to landscape design principles?

  1. A. Hogarth, symmetrical, curvature

  2. B. Stratify, random, curvature

  3. C. Thresh, rounding, complexity

  4. D. Focalization, proportion, simplicity

The correct answer is: D. Focalization, proportion, simplicity

The correct choice focuses on terms that are integral to the principles of landscape design. Focalization refers to the creation of a visual anchor or point of interest within a landscape, drawing the viewer's eye and providing a sense of hierarchy in the design. Proportion deals with the spatial relationships and scale of the elements within the landscape, ensuring that they complement each other harmoniously. Simplicity is an essential principle that emphasizes the idea of minimalism in design, allowing for clarity and ease of understanding in the landscape layout.
